Master in Energy and Green Architecture MEGAs target group is architects, engineers and constructors, as well as other professions with at least 2 years of professional experience.
The master education, MEGA, takes place at Aarhus School of Architecture in Aarhus, Denmark, as well as at THUPDI, Beijing, China.
MEGA is based on education sessions, split in 4 modules, and the teachers attending are experts within the actual module themes. The MEGA master counts for 60 ECTS points, which equals 1 year of full time studying or 1/2 year of studying half time.
During the first semester there is one session in Denmark, Aarhus and one session in China, Beijing.
Included in the education sessions in Aarhus is a study trip to Austria and Germany, and included in the education session in Beijing is a study tour round of Beijing.
The second semester consists of literature study and exercise on innovation, and two virtual innovation studies — in city scale and in architectural scale, respectively.
Third semester is focused on implementation and includes a two week workshop in Beijing in cooperation with Chinese and Danish companies.
Apart from the education sessions, MEGA is based on e-learning, group work via Internet (Skype), literature study and exercise.
The cost of the Master in Energy and Green Architecture is: 25.000 EURO.
This sum total includes education and education materials, food during courses, two travels (Beijing-Aarhus/ Aarhus-Beijing) including flight and hotel with breakfast, and one study trip to Austria and Germany including transportation and hotel with breakfast.
